Butler: Moore getting the best out of Rovers

22 October 2020

Andy Butler says manager Darren Moore’s meticulous approach is getting the best out of the Rovers squad this season.

Rovers have won four of their opening six league games, and Butler says that is a result of everybody knowing their role within the squad. 

He said: “The togetherness is a big thing for us, the philosophy the manager and his staff have brought to the club has been outstanding. 

“They demand a lot off every single player whether you’re in the starting XI or not, and that rubs off on everyone. 

“They’re managing people individually as well as a squad, they give great amount of detail every day on the training ground.” 

Butler has had to be patient so far with the form of Tom Anderson and Joe Wright, and says he is ready to go whenever called upon. 

He added: “I’m always ready to step in when needed, I’m not knocking on the gaffer’s door because the players in front of me have been outstanding.  

“They’ve both shown maturity and composure throughout their game, they’re getting better and better and really complement each other. 

“It’s fierce competition all over the pitch and I’m more than ready to play whenever the manager needs me.”
